> The benchmark indeed shows that this latest addition to the group slows down random and sequential access, especially for small numbers of values and classes. The OpenJDK tests are fine; I'm running a batch of internal tests as well.
>
> Given that one concern with this issue, next to reducing footprint, was to optimise for the single-value case, I'm still a bit hesitant even though the sheer amount of code reduction is impressive. I'll evaluate further.
The main motivation to optimize for the single-value use case is Graal but it’s not super important. Graal solved this issue in a different way and it’s questionable Graal would go back using ClassValue so don’t worry too much about it.

Because I found bugs in expunging logic and a discrepancy of behavior when a value is installed concurrently by some other thread and then later removed while the 1st thread is still calculating the value. Current ClassValue re-tries the computation until it can make sure there were no concurrent changes to the entry during its computation. I fixed both things and verified that the behavior is now the same:
